Step-by-Step Guide to Connect Ring to Your Phone

Now that you have all the prerequisites, let’s jump into the step-by-step process of connecting your Ring device to your phone.

Step 1: Set Up Your Ring Device

  1. Unbox and Install: Remove the Ring device from its packaging and install it according to the manufacturer’s instructions. Most Ring devices come with a series of installation guides or videos that help ensure proper placement.

  2. Power On the Device: If your Ring device requires batteries, make sure it’s powered correctly. For hardwired Ring devices, ensure they are connected to a power source.

Step 2: Download the Ring App

  1. Go to App Store: Open the Google Play Store or Apple App Store on your smartphone.

  2. Search for Ring: Type “Ring” in the search bar and look for the official Ring App created by Ring, Inc.

  3. Install the App: Click on the install button, and wait for the app to download and install.

Step 3: Create a Ring Account

  1. Open the Ring App: Tap the Ring app icon to open it.

  2. Create Account: If you don’t have an account, select “Create Account” and follow the prompts to set up your account. You will need to provide an email address and create a password.

Step 4: Connecting Your Device

  1. Select “Set Up a Device”: Once logged in, tap on the option “Set Up a Device”.

  2. Choose Device Type: Select the type of Ring device you are setting up, such as a Ring Video Doorbell or Ring Camera.

  3. Scan the QR Code: Your Ring device will have a QR code located on the back or on the setup instructions. Use the phone camera to scan this code, or enter the code manually when prompted.

Step 5: Connect to Wi-Fi

  1. Wi-Fi Selection: The app will prompt you to connect your Ring device to a Wi-Fi network. Select your home Wi-Fi network from the list that appears.

  2. Enter Password: Type in your Wi-Fi password when prompted and click “Connect”.

  3. Wait for Connection: The Ring device will take a few moments to connect to your Wi-Fi network. Please ensure that you are in range of the Wi-Fi signal during this step.

Step 6: Finalize Setup

  1. Set Device Name: After the device connects to Wi-Fi, you may be prompted to assign it a name for easier identification.

  2. Test the Device: The app will guide you through testing the device to ensure it’s functioning correctly, such as verifying that the camera is working and that you can access live feeds.

Step 7: Configure Notifications

To make the most out of your connected Ring device, ensure that you configure notifications according to your preferences.

  1. Open Notifications Settings: Go to the settings within the Ring app.

  2. Customize Alerts: Choose how you want to be notified about motion alerts, visitor rings, and other features, ensuring that you don’t miss important alerts.

Troubleshooting Common Connection Issues

Sometimes, connecting your Ring device to your phone may not go as smoothly as planned. Here are some common issues and troubleshooting steps:

1. Connection Failed

If you receive a message saying that your Ring device could not connect, try the following:

  • Check Wi-Fi Signal: Ensure your Ring device is within the range of your router.
  • Restart Your Router: Restart your Wi-Fi router and try the connection process again.

2. App Crashes or Freezes

If the Ring app crashes or freezes during setup:

  1. Update Your App: Check for any updates for the Ring app in the App Store or Google Play Store.

  2. Reinstall the App: Uninstall the app and reinstall it to resolve any issues.

3. Incompatible Device

Ensure your Ring device is compatible with your phone’s operating system. If outdated, consider updating your smartphone or using a different device to connect.

How do I set up notifications for my Ring device?

To set up notifications for your Ring device, launch the Ring app on your phone and navigate to the device you want to configure. Tap on the device image to access its settings. Look for the option labeled “Device Settings,” then select “Alert Settings” or “Notification Settings,” depending on your app version. Here, you can customize which notifications you would like to receive, such as motion alerts or doorbell rings.

Once you have modified your alert preferences, ensure that notifications are enabled for the Ring app within your phone’s overall settings. This allows you to receive timely alerts whenever your Ring device detects motion or someone rings the doorbell, enhancing your home security and keeping you informed about activity around your property.

Is my Ring device compatible with my phone model?

Ring devices are compatible with most iPhones and Android smartphones, but it is always important to check the specific requirements based on your device model and operating system version. Generally, the Ring app requires iOS 12 or later for Apple devices and Android 6.0 or later for Android devices. Make sure your phone meets these operating system requirements before attempting to download the app.

To verify compatibility, you can visit the Ring website or check the app’s page on the App Store or Google Play Store. They often provide details on device compatibility. If you find that your phone model is not compatible, you may need to consider updating your operating system or changing devices to use your Ring device effectively.
